Behavioral Economics and the Cumulative Impact of Tiny Actions

Behavioral economics reveals how small nudges—intentional design of choices—can guide better decisions. Choice architecture, such as automating savings, leverages human tendencies toward inertia to build wealth quietly and steadily. Research shows even modest savings plans grow exponentially over years due to compound interest and disciplined habit formation.

Small Action Immediate Benefit Long-Term Impact
Automate $50 weekly savings Reduces decision fatigue Builds financial security over time
Practice five minutes of mindfulness daily Lower stress levels Enhanced focus and emotional stability
Save one coffee per week Minor daily sacrifice Accumulates to meaningful funds annually

Systems of small choices reduce decision fatigue by simplifying routines and aligning actions with long-term goals, fostering sustainable progress without overwhelming willpower.

The Role of Environment in Reinforcing Daily Choices

Our surroundings shape behavior more than we realize. Placing a book on the nightstand invites quiet reflection instead of passive screen time. Similarly, keeping healthy snacks visible encourages nourishing choices. Environmental design acts as a silent architect—guiding habits through convenience and visibility.

Example: A dedicated reading nook with soft lighting signals the brain to relax and engage deeply. By designing spaces that support positive actions, we reduce reliance on motivation and increase automatic alignment with our values.

Mindset and Awareness: Cultivating Intentional Small Choices

Mindfulness turns automatic behaviors into conscious decisions. Practices like journaling or using habit trackers heighten awareness of daily patterns, revealing opportunities for intentional shifts. A simple morning reflection asking, “How do I want to show up today?” transforms routine into purpose.

  1. Use a habit tracker to visualize progress on small goals.
  2. Set daily intention prompts to align actions with values.
  3. Review choices weekly to reinforce mindful patterns.

This awareness turns routine into ritual—each choice a deliberate step toward the life you want to live.
